Failed installation of trial versions of Enterprise and Universal Forwarder on domain accounts.

I am installing the trial version of Splunk Enterprise on Windows 10 pro 64bit. When I use a domain account the installation fails. But when I use a local account the installation succeeds.

Do the trial versions of Splunk Enterprise and Universal Forwarder support domain accounts?

Hello @magicbytes,

the installation can fail if the domain user don't have required permissions.

Check the %TEMP%\MSI*.log (usually c:\Windows\Temp\MSI*.log or c:\Users_username_\AppData\Local\Temp\MSI*.log) direct after the failed installation. If unsure, post the log here.
